A record number of golfers hit the links at Lake Breeze Golf Club Friday, June 9, for the 2017 Football Golf Outing. The fundraising event, held by the League of Titans–Football, involved more than 200 golfers this year.

The number of participants was not only a record-high for the University of Wisconsin-Oshkosh Titan football golf outing itself but also for Lake Breeze Golf Club.

The outing included nearly 50 golfing foursomes for the 18-hole scramble, a 50/50 raffle, many raffle items, and lunch and dinner provided.

Pat Cerroni, Titan football head coach, was grateful to those who had a hand in making the event such a success and thankful for all who came out and enjoyed the fun-filled day.

“From our coaching staff to players, we want to thank all the wonderful people that participated and sponsored our golf outing. It was a tremendous success,” Cerroni said.

2017 Football Golf Outing

The golf outing is one of many fundraising events the League of Titans–Football organizes. The event funds the football program in many areas, including general support and support for players, coaches and recognition.

The football program is coming off a season that saw the Titans reach the national championship game for the first time in school history. It also was a season of tremendous success off the field. As a team, the Titans volunteered more than 1,000 hours in the community, including two Feed America Mobile Food Drives (one of which fed a record-high 500 families in the Fox Valley).
